Three Emergency Issue Hong Kong Government $1 notes overprinted on Chinese 5 yuan banknotes all running in sequence B045651,B045653, B045652.  The notes were issued in 1941 shortly before the surrender of British forces to the Japanese Army. 
The vendor's father Ronald Sleap was based on Hong Kong from 1938 working for AS Watson.  During the war he was a Lieutenant in the 3rd Artillery Battalion of the Hong Kong Volunteer Defence force.  Interred by the Japanese in 1941 in Civilian Camp N (a postcard by Mr Sleap from the Internment Camp sold at Spinks for $2200HKD - auction CSS68 lot 615),  later released in 1945 he remained in Hong Kong until 1968.
